Hien Luong Bridge

Hien Luong Bridge, built in 1952, crosses the Ben Hai River in Quang Tri Province. During the Vietnam War, it marked the dividing line between North and South Vietnam from 1954 to 1975. Nowadays, the bridge stands as a symbol of Vietnam’s reunification and a reminder of the nation’s strength and perseverance.

La Vang Holy Land

La Vang Holy Land, located in Quang Tri Province, is a significant Catholic pilgrimage site built in honor of the Virgin Mary, who reportedly appeared here in 1798 during religious persecution. These days, it functions as a spiritual sanctuary and a gathering place for thousands of worshippers during annual celebrations, symbolizing faith and resilience.

Vinh Moc Tunnels

Built between 1965 and 1967 during the Vietnam War, the Vinh Moc Tunnels were a safe underground shelter for local villagers escaping heavy American bombings. Stretching over 2 kilometers, the tunnels included homes, a school, a clinic, and shared spaces, showing the strength and creativity of the people. These days, it stands as a powerful reminder of the struggles and determination of those who lived through the war.

Dakrong Bridge

Dakrong Bridge, built in 1975, played a key role during the Vietnam War as part of the Ho Chi Minh Trail, connecting supply routes for North Vietnamese forces. Nowadays, it serves as a vital link for locals in Quang Tri Province, symbolizing resilience and unity in Vietnam’s history.

Khe Sanh Combat Base

Khe Sanh Combat Base, active during the Vietnam War from 1966 to 1971, was a strategic U.S. military outpost used to block North Vietnamese troops along the Ho Chi Minh Trail. It became famous for the 1968 Battle of Khe Sanh, symbolizing the intense conflict and resilience of soldiers on both sides.
